Commit Graph

766 Commits (a52f6ec02a92e8a663cbf11a4b7d341273459828)

Author SHA1 Message Date
DarienRaymond 1dadd54502
Merge pull request #985 from yujinqiu/yet-another-typo
7 years ago
Jinqiu Yu eb38f4865e Fix another typo
7 years ago
Jinqiu Yu 2d5aa9514f consistent ServerSpec var
7 years ago
Darien Raymond b2d9364cb5
release buffer if payload becomes small
7 years ago
Darien Raymond 000e0804e8
fix buffer recycling
7 years ago
DarienRaymond a8a68c2e70
Merge pull request #962 from yujinqiu/fix-typo
7 years ago
Darien Raymond b5b9a83823
reorder fields in Destination for faster hashing
7 years ago
Jinqiu Yu 855925a805 Fix typo
7 years ago
Darien Raymond 087c0c1499
refine address family type
7 years ago
Darien Raymond b4e1240160
comments
7 years ago
Darien Raymond 1cbfeea0cd
simplify NewSize calls
7 years ago
Darien Raymond 0c213ccd20
reset buffer when free
7 years ago
Darien Raymond 5bbece14af
simplify pool creation
7 years ago
Darien Raymond 34c12c1af6
extend buffer
7 years ago
Darien Raymond 931c8597ca
fix len -> cap
7 years ago
Darien Raymond 994aecd13c
rename NewLocal to NewSize
7 years ago
Darien Raymond f97e6fa3d2
refine buffer allocation
7 years ago
Jinqiu Yu 87dd1ed877 Fix receivced, InboundBound, tranport, Enpoint typo
7 years ago
Darien Raymond eaf043f1b3
reduce memory usage of Buffer
7 years ago
Darien Raymond fbc025869b
fix lint errors
7 years ago
Jinqiu Yu 8864195b50 Fix executable typo
7 years ago
Darien Raymond 9100a78914
refactor
7 years ago
Darien Raymond a52eb8f82b
allow underscore in domain name. fixes #917
7 years ago
Darien Raymond d207d953bd
h2 transport
7 years ago
Darien Raymond a7d467992d
try parse domain address as IP. fixes #894.
7 years ago
Darien Raymond 2b4104e491
benchmark for dice
7 years ago
Darien Raymond a42b4b513e
test case for write address
7 years ago
Darien Raymond af1abf687c
unify all address reading and writing
7 years ago
Darien Raymond 546c2fb226
settings for forcing secure encryption in vmess server
7 years ago
Darien Raymond df34931ab3
fix log test
7 years ago
Darien Raymond bc1979400e
simplify log
7 years ago
Darien Raymond 6b872c266c
session id
7 years ago
Darien Raymond 098244530b
update Must2
7 years ago
Darien Raymond b3fd320be7
more test cases
7 years ago
Darien Raymond b3e46f5d07
fix error handling in buf.Copy
7 years ago
Darien Raymond c48fa50ab1
logger service
7 years ago
Darien Raymond ccb2a9f168
comments
7 years ago
Darien Raymond ae4dece6b0
explictly use the io.Writer instance for writing net.Buffers
7 years ago
Darien Raymond 20fc4950b2
comments
7 years ago
Darien Raymond 997c852be8
remove unused code
7 years ago
Darien Raymond 42d83a703e
fix transfer for mux
7 years ago
Darien Raymond 87ba7dd0d1
implement remove user in vmess
7 years ago
Darien Raymond f8ce1945e1
remove unused code
7 years ago
Darien Raymond c368412728
test case for periodic task
7 years ago
Darien Raymond efcb567273
remove context in struct
7 years ago
Darien Raymond ede2c39967
non-blocking timer. Fixes #848
7 years ago
Darien Raymond 0e01e28278
use uuid as struct
7 years ago
Darien Raymond 7d2c34f674
remove unused code
7 years ago
Darien Raymond 292d7cc353
massive refactoring for interoperability
7 years ago
Darien Raymond 5a3c7fdd20
remove use of unsafe
7 years ago